Имя: Пароль:
1C
1С v8
План обмена для чайника
0 Генетический мусор
 
10.07.16
17:01
Есть план обмена между центральной и перифирийной. Необходим еще обмен между перифирийной и еще более перифирийной. Скопировал план обмена в новый объект, потыкал что нужно что не нужно. Открываю свой план обмена - кнопки "создать начальный образ", "зарегистрировать изменения", "прочитать изменения" - неактивны, что я Вася - я курю...для плана своего пытаюсь вызвать РегистрацияИзмененийДляОбмена...ПланыОбмена.ЗарегистрироватьИзменения(УзелОбмена, СтрокаТипаДанных.Данные);, где узелобмена - явно мой, СтрокаТипаДанных.Данные - объект с авторегистрацией.

спасибо (что я дебил я знаю, до сих пор планы обмена не юзал)
1 Генетический мусор
 
10.07.16
17:02
а, на строке регистрации - {Обработка.РегистрацияИзмененийДляОбмена.Форма.Форма.Форма(857)}: Ошибка при вызове метода контекста (ЗарегистрироватьИзменения)
            ПланыОбмена.ЗарегистрироватьИзменения(УзелОбмена, СтрокаТипаДанных.Данные);
по причине:
Недопустимое значение параметра (параметр номер '1')
2 Nylander85
 
10.07.16
18:12
Советую пригласить специалиста.
3 Генетический мусор
 
10.07.16
18:27
я дебил (с)
спс, понял
4 youalex
 
10.07.16
19:09
(1) ну, дык для своего узла не получится изменения зарегистрировать. Изменения регистрируются для узлов (читай - баз) куда их требуется передать.
5 Defender aka LINN
 
10.07.16
20:28
(1) Объект не входит в состав плана обмена
6 FIXXXL
 
11.07.16
09:06
(3) два узла надо, ЭтотУзел(твоя база) и узел, куда выгружать изменения
во второй регистрируй
7 Генетический мусор
 
13.07.16
13:45
спс, я и говорю, я дебил, в понятиях запутался)